Description

Panduit CMPH1 Open-Access Horizontal Dual-Sided Cable Manager

The Panduit CMPH1 delivers front-and-rear cable routing in a single rack unit for datacenter, server room, and AV installations where power, coaxial, and Cat6/fiber bundles converge. Dual D-ring design—3-inch depth front, 5-inch depth rear—lets you separate upstream backbone from downstream device connections without cross-interference or bundle sag. Modular plastic snap-in rings on a welded steel chassis combine 12 lb load capacity with tool-free reconfiguration: pull a ring, reroute the run, snap it back. Open-Access architecture exposes cable paths from both sides of the rack, cutting adds-moves-changes from a ten-minute pull-and-replug to a thirty-second lift-and-drop.

Why dual-sided matters in converged racks. Single-depth managers force power, data, and coax into one horizontal bundle, creating a rat's nest where tracing a failed link means peeling twenty cables apart. The CMPH1's front-to-rear split mirrors your logical flow: shallow front D-rings catch 6-inch device jumpers and SFP DACs; deep rear rings hold trunk bundles and AC whips entering from the cabinet roof or floor. When you commission a new switch or replace a failed PSU, you work in the front D-ring only—backend infrastructure stays untouched. In high-churn environments—MSP colos, integrator test labs, building-automation head-ends—that segregation cuts troubleshooting time in half and eliminates the "which cable?" guess that breaks SLAs.

Deployment and integration. Mount between every three to five rack units of active gear—NVRs, PoE switches, KVM drawers, UPS shelves—to capture slack before it droops across intake vents or snags on a sliding rail. The 8.6-inch total depth (frame plus rear D-ring) fits shallow 24-inch telecom racks and deep 42-inch server cabinets alike; no interference with square-hole, round-hole, or threaded EIA rails. Plastic D-rings ship pre-installed but slide off their steel track in seconds: if a six-ring layout leaves gaps, redistribute four rings to the front and two to the rear, or vice versa, without hardware or cage nuts. Pair with Panduit vertical managers on the cabinet sides for a complete pathway that routes bundles down the frame, across the CMPH1 horizontal, and into patch panels or device rear ports with zero unsupported span.
